What Is a Dispatchable Location in E911?
The term “dispatchable location” comes directly from the Kari’s Law and RAY BAUM’S Act regulatory framework, which the FCC finalized and phased into enforcement beginning in 2021. Understanding the definition precisely matters, because vague location data is exactly what gets schools into trouble.
A dispatchable location is defined as the street address of a caller plus additional information that allows a first responder to find the caller’s exact location within a building. That additional information typically includes:
- Floor number
- Room number or suite
- Wing, building name, or other location identifier
A plain street address — even a correct one — does not qualify as a dispatchable location. This is the critical distinction that many school IT administrators miss.
Under Kari’s Law, every multi-line telephone system (MLTS) must allow any user to dial 911 directly without pressing a prefix (like “9” first). Under RAY BAUM’S Act, that same system must transmit a dispatchable location to the PSAP (Public Safety Answering Point) — the dispatch center that receives your 911 call. Both laws apply directly to school telephone systems.
Why Schools Face a Higher Risk Than Most Buildings
Schools aren’t just another commercial building. They present a specific set of challenges that make E911 compliance both more complex and more urgent.
Scale and density. A single school campus may have hundreds of phones spread across multiple buildings, portable classrooms, gymnasiums, cafeterias, and administrative wings. Each of those locations needs a distinct, addressable identity in your PBX.
High-stakes emergencies. School emergencies — whether a medical incident, a fire, or a security threat — require first responders to reach a precise location quickly. An EMT who arrives at the main entrance of a 400-room building without knowing the caller is in the second-floor science lab loses critical time.
Extension sprawl. Many schools still run aging PBX configurations where every phone shares a single outbound caller ID or emergency location record. This means a 911 call from a portable classroom on the east side of campus may transmit the address of the administrative office on the west side.
Student and staff safety culture. Unlike a corporate office, a school phone may be used in an emergency by a child, a substitute teacher, or a visitor who has no idea how to describe their exact location to a dispatcher. The system has to do the work automatically.
Liability exposure. School districts that fail to maintain compliant E911 configurations face potential civil liability if a delayed emergency response can be traced to inaccurate or missing location data in their PBX.

Step-by-Step: Configuring E911 Dispatchable Location in VitalPBX
Here’s a practical workflow for IT administrators setting up compliant E911 for a school environment.
Step 1 — Inventory every extension and its physical location.
Create a spreadsheet mapping each extension number to its exact location: building name, floor, room number. This is your source of truth for everything that follows.
Step 2 — Register emergency DIDs with your SIP trunk provider.
Contact your SIP trunk provider and register a unique DID (or use your existing DIDs) for each distinct physical location you need to identify. Provide the street address plus the dispatchable location details (floor, room, building) for each DID. Providers that support E911 from Bandwidth, Twilio, or NENA-compliant carriers can store this data against each DID.
Step 3 — Assign Emergency CIDs in VitalPBX.
In VitalPBX, navigate to each extension’s settings and enter the Emergency CID that corresponds to that extension’s registered physical location. This overrides the general outbound caller ID specifically for 911 calls.
Step 4 — Configure your Emergency Outbound Route.
Create or verify a dedicated outbound route for emergency calls (matching 911 and any local emergency numbers). Assign your E911-registered trunks to this route with appropriate failover ordering.
Step 5 — Test every location.
Use your carrier’s E911 test procedures (most NENA-compliant carriers offer a test number, often 933) to verify that each extension transmits the correct location data before going live. Document your test results.
Step 6 — Review quarterly.
Every time an extension moves, a classroom is reassigned, or a new building is added to campus, your E911 records must be updated. Build a quarterly audit into your IT calendar.

Is Kari’s Law required for school phone systems?
Yes. Kari’s Law applies to all multi-line telephone systems (MLTS) installed, manufactured, or imported in the United States on or after February 16, 2020. It requires that any user can dial 911 directly — without dialing a prefix like “9” first — and that the system notifies an on-site contact simultaneously with the 911 call. Schools are not exempt.

What happens if a school’s PBX sends only a street address to 911?
If your PBX sends only a street address without the additional dispatchable location data (floor, room, building), it does not meet the RAY BAUM’S Act requirement. Dispatchers receive an incomplete location record, which slows response time. Additionally, the school or district may be exposed to regulatory enforcement and civil liability if a delayed response results in harm.
